The noun 'corgi' is a common noun, a word for a breed of herding dog.
The type of corgi named for its region of origin is a proper noun:
Welsh corgi
Penbroke corgi (or Pembroke Welsh corgi)
Cardigan Welsh corgi
As a name of a road , Park Avenue', it is a proper noun, and both words star with a capital letter. However, when used separately, as 'the park, or 'the avenue', they are common nouns and so not need a capital letter.
